XAT 2026 Preparation Guide – XLRI Jamshedpur Admission Strategy

XAT 2026 – Complete Preparation Guide

XAT (Xavier Aptitude Test) is the gateway to XLRI Jamshedpur — India's premier HR and Business Management school. Unlike CAT, XAT has a unique Decision Making section that tests ethical dilemmas and complex reasoning scenarios.

XAT 2026 Exam Pattern

Part 1 (190 minutes): Decision Making (21 questions), Verbal & Logical Ability (26 questions), Quantitative Ability & Data Interpretation (27 questions). Part 2 (35 minutes): General Knowledge (25 questions, not counted in percentile). Total time: 3 hours 25 minutes.

XAT vs CAT – Key Differences

XAT has Decision Making (unique section — no CAT equivalent). XAT GK section doesn't affect percentile but affects XLRI shortlist. XAT Verbal is more reading-heavy. XAT Quantitative is slightly easier than CAT. XAT essay: Not required from 2023 onwards. XLRI accepts only XAT scores (not CAT).

Decision Making Preparation Tips

Decision Making is the most unique and difficult section. It covers business scenarios, ethical dilemmas, and case-based questions. Strategy: Practice with XLRI's published DM papers. Read case studies from HBR (Harvard Business Review). Learn frameworks: Stakeholder analysis, Cost-benefit analysis, Ethical decision frameworks.

XLRI Jamshedpur Cutoffs 2026 (Expected)

BM (Business Management): 95+ percentile overall. HRM (Human Resource Management): 93+ percentile overall. Both programs require minimum section-wise cutoffs — typically 70-75 percentile per section. GPA: 95%+ shortlisted typically have above 65-70% academic scores.

6-Month XAT Study Plan

Month 1-2: Quant + Verbal fundamentals (same as CAT). Month 3-4: DM practice + GK building. Month 5: XAT specific mocks + previous year papers. Month 6: Full XAT mocks (2-3 per week). Goal: 5+ full XAT mocks in final month.
